Cleaning Vomit In Vehicles: What You Need To Know For Health And Safety A simple car sickness incident can quickly turn into a permanent property loss. Did you know that human vomit is classified as a biohazard? It can contain high levels of norovirus and other dangerous pathogens. These microbes can survive on vehicle surfaces for up to two weeks.   • Are services available for food-related businesses?

    Yes, professional odor removal services are available for food-related businesses such as restaurants and kitchens. These establishments often face challenges with lingering food, grease, and smoke odors. Professionals address these issues by cleaning grease traps, ventilation systems, and kitchen surfaces. Enzymatic cleaners are used to break down organic matter, ensuring thorough odor removal. Regular maintenance and professional treatments help food-related businesses maintain a clean and welcoming environment for customers and staff.
